Quick Start Laravel 4

Hai sobat semua, bertemu lagi di Quick Start Laravel 4. Kali ini saya ingin mencontohkan dalam pembuatan sebuah master pada suatu database. Disini masih di database yang sama seperti sebelumnya, Kita akan membuat CRUD ( Create, Read, Update, Delete ) pada suatu master.


Langsung saja yaa, master yang akan kita kelola adalah supplier. Sebelumnya sobat semua sudah taukan apa itu CRUD ? Secara simple yang dimaksud CRUD adalah kita bisa mengelola data yang dimilki dari sebuah tabel dalam hal ini adalah tabel supplier, maksudnya kita bisa melihat data, membuat data baru, mengedit data,  dan menghapus data.
Pertama kita identifikasi dulu, data supplier memiliki beberapa informasi yang dibutuhkan yaitu :
  1.  Kode supplier
  2. Nama supplier 
  3. No telepon
  4. Alamat
 Dari identifikasi tersebut kita dapat membuat rancangan tabel dari supplier, sebagai berikut:

Ssetelah itu yang perlu kita lakukan adalah : 
  1.  Environment Local ( bootstrap/start.php )
  2. Database koneksi ( app/config/local/database.php )
  3. Instalasi paket “Way/Generators” di laravel. Buka file composer.json yang terletak diluar menjadi seperti ini : 
  4. Kemudian masuk ke command ketik composer update
  5. Tunggu hingga proses selesai, kemudian masuk ke folder app/config/app.php tambahkan seperti ini
  6. Sekarang coba di chek yaa ketik php artisan jika berhasil akan seperti ini
Setelah berhasil kemudian langkahnya adalah :
  1. Membuat model : ketik di command php artisan generate:model Supplier
  2. Kemudian edit di app/models/Supplier tambahkan field yang dibutuhkan.
  3. Membuat migration : ketik php artisan generate:migration create_supplier_table
  4. Kemudian edit di app/database/migrations/create_supplier_table tambahkan keterangan yang dibutuhkan. Setalah itu jangan lupa ketik di command php artisan migrate
 Membuat controller
  1. Ketik di php artisan generate:controller SupplierController (di pembahasan selanjunya akan di terangkan )
    Membuat view
Ketik perintah di bawah in secara bergantian :

php artisan generate:view supplier.index 

php artisan generate:view supplier.create

php artisan generate:view supplier.edit



Wah ternyata sudah panjang tutorial nya,dari pada sobat semua bosen mending di lanjut di berikunya yaa. Untuk CRUD nya dilanjut di postingan berikutnya. hanya di Quick Start Laravel 5 ( CRUD part 1 )

Semoga bermanfaat semuaa, bila ada yang kurang jelas atau ditanyakan komen saja. Dan nantikan postingan berikutnya yang berisi tentang pengelolaan master supplier yang telah kita buat tadi. Sampai jumpa sobat

0 komentar:

Post a Comment